Hungary give-back 'a great thing' which boosted Hamilton's motivation

Lewis Hamilton says the Hungarian Grand Prix was a great moment for Mercedes and a turning point for his personal motivation. Outqualified by Valtteri Bottas at the Hungaroring, Hamilton overtook his team mate on team orders but ultimately gave the position back after failing to mount an attack on leader Sebastian Vettel. The move solidified Mercedes' team spirit but it also pushed the four-time world champion to make sure the circumstances weren't repeated in the future. "We did a great thing for the team that had a positive ripple effect," Hamilton said on Friady at the FIA's annual prize-giving media conference.
